Novel Drug Delivery Systems: Advancements and Applications

Drug delivery systems cutting-edge are continuously evolving to enhance therapeutic efficacy and patient outcomes. Recent breakthroughs in nanotechnology, polymers, and biomaterials have paved the way for novel drug carriers that exhibit precise release profiles and improved bioavailability. These advancements hold significant promise for treating a wide range of diseases, from cancer and infectious diseases to chronic conditions such as diabetes and cardiovascular disease.

Among the most promising developments in drug delivery are:

  • Nanoparticles, which can encapsulate both hydrophilic and hydrophobic drugs, enhancing their solubility and stability.
  • Patches, offering localized and sustained drug release at the site of action.
  • Responsive materials, which respond to specific stimuli such as pH or temperature, enabling triggered drug delivery.

The development of these novel drug delivery systems is revolutionizing medicine by improving treatment outcomes, minimizing side effects, and enhancing patient compliance.

Navigating the Complexities of Prescription Drug Interactions

Prescription drugs can be a lifesaver for managing various health concerns. However, understanding the potential effects between different medications is vital for ensuring patient safety and maximizing treatment effectiveness. When multiple drugs are administered simultaneously, they can influence each other's absorption, metabolism, and elimination from the body. This can lead to a range of negative outcomes, including reduced drug potency, increased side effects, or even severe complications.

  • For effectively navigate this complex landscape, patients should collaborate their healthcare providers and pharmacists. Open and honest communication about all medications being taken, including over-the-counter drugs, supplements, and herbal remedies, is crucial.
  • Pharmacists play a key role in identifying potential concerns and providing personalized guidance to patients. They can help modify medication regimens to minimize the risk of adverse effects and ensure that medications are used safely and effectively.
